1966 Arkansas Gubernatorial Election
Who won the 1966 Arkansas Gubernatorial Election?
Winthrop Rockefeller won the 1966 Arkansas Gubernatorial Election. Winthrop Rockefeller received 306,324 popular votes (54.36%). The main challenger was James D. Johnson (45.64%).
